Chess, a game with a rich history dating back centuries, has evolved significantly in terms of strategy and gameplay. Initially designed to simulate warfare on a battlefield, chess strategies have become increasingly complex, with players around the world developing and refining tactics to gain an edge over their opponents. One of the foundational strategies involves controlling the centre of the board, a principle that has remained throughout the ages. Mastery of openings, a critical aspect of any player's repertoire, can set the tone for the battle that unfolds. For instance, the King's Pawn opening, symbolised as e4, is aimed at immediately asserting dominance by space and creating pathways for other pieces.
